## Data Stores: Greenhouse Sensor Drift

FYI for the release cut: the Fernhatch controller logs raw sensor readings and a drift-corrected value side by side. Humidity probes drift about 2% per month, so the recalibration job runs nightly and writes offsets to the `drift_offsets` table. If a release changes the correction formula, the offsets must be rebuilt first. To run the rebuild script against the telemetry store, use the connection string below.

primary connection of tawif-yajeg = postgresql://rusiel_svc:G879q9cx6GsSvj@db-dd9f.norvagrid.internal:5432/casath

CI note: cron jobs moved to the Tressel workflow engine last sprint. Old crontab entries on the Marwick runners are disabled, not deleted — leave them until Q3. If a scheduled job misses, check Tressel's trigger log first; clock skew on the runners caused phantom skips twice already. Retries are handled by the engine now, so remove any wrapper scripts. Reference the run via the token below.

trace token, fafog-kageg: htk4_98e6

Subject: DR Drill Thursday — Pinning Policy Reminder

Hi on-call,

During Thursday's Brindlewood disaster-recovery drill, rebuild only from the pinned manifest; floating dependency versions are forbidden during the drill window, as unpinned builds invalidated our last recovery timing results. If the pinned mirror is unreachable, fail over to the sealed fallback archive. The archive prompts for the recovery passphrase, which follows below.

unlock words, hahip-baduf: holwyn-istath-julvan

## InvoicePress 2.8 — Default changes

Heads up for the release notes: the PDF invoice renderer now defaults to embedded fonts, A4 page size, and a 90-second render timeout instead of the old unlimited one. Most tenants won't notice, but anyone overriding page size should double-check margins. Nothing breaking, just saner out-of-the-box behavior. The new shipped defaults are as follows.

service settings:
PRAWYN_PIN=9848
PRAWYN_METRICS_HOST=metrics.prawyn.lumicworks.corp
PRAWYN_LOG_LEVEL=warn
PRAWYN_TENANT=pelius